Patriots sign defensive tackle Jeremiah Pharms to two-year contract extension

The Patriots have signed defensive tackle Jeremiah Pharms to a two-year context extension, according to his representatives.

The 28-year-old, who entered the NFL as an undrafted free agent in 2022, was set to become an exclusive-rights free agent next month.

The 6-foot-2-inch Pharms played in 16 games during the 2024 season and made five starts. He had 33 tackles, 2 sacks, and 5 quarterback hits.

Patriots DT Jeremiah Pharms Jr., who was an exclusive rights free agent, has agreed to a 2-year deal, according to his agency @OSMG_LLC.

The deal is expected to include a $100k signing bonus and $250k guaranteed.
